Essential Dietary Principles for Effective Weight Control
Adopting certain dietary principles can greatly support effective weight control. Focusing on whole, unprocessed foods ensures the body receives vital nutrients and maintains energy balance. Fresh fruits, vegetables, lean protein sources, whole grains, and healthy fats should form the cornerstone of a well-rounded diet. Portion awareness is equally important, helping to prevent overeating while maintaining nutrient intake. Reducing consumption of processed and high-sugar foods, such as sugary snacks and fizzy drinks, minimises the intake of empty calories and supports a more balanced diet.
Hydration also plays a key role in weight control. Drinking sufficient water throughout the day not only aids digestion but also helps to distinguish between hunger and thirst, reducing the likelihood of unnecessary snacking. Eating at consistent times and avoiding meal skipping can further stabilise energy levels and curb late-day overeating. Incorporating snacks that are rich in protein or fibre can help maintain satiety between meals, making it easier to stay on track.
Mindful eating practices, such as chewing food slowly and focusing on each meal without distractions, encourage a deeper connection to hunger and fullness signals. These practices reduce the tendency to eat in response to stress or boredom. Building these habits into daily routines can provide a structured foundation for long-term, effective weight management.

Tracking Progress for Sustainable Weight Loss
Tracking progress is essential to ensuring sustainable weight loss, as it helps individuals remain consistent and make necessary adjustments to their strategies. Regular monitoring can reveal patterns and highlight areas that require improvement or modification.
Setting Measurable Goals
Establishing clear and achievable objectives is vital for tracking progress effectively. Goals should be specific, measurable, and time-bound to provide direction and motivation.
Maintaining a Food Diary
Recording daily food intake helps identify eating habits and provides insights into calorie consumption. A food diary also helps identify emotional triggers and times of day when unhealthy choices are more likely.
Tracking Physical Activity
Documenting exercise routines and duration offers a clear picture of physical activity levels. Monitoring improvements, such as increased stamina or strength, serves as an additional motivator.
Monitoring Body Composition
Beyond weight, tracking metrics such as body fat percentage, muscle mass, and measurements can provide a more comprehensive understanding of progress, as these factors better reflect overall health.

Mindful Eating Techniques to Support Healthy Habits
Mindful eating emphasises a deliberate, attentive approach to eating, fostering greater awareness of eating behaviours and patterns. By slowing down and focusing on the act of eating, individuals can better identify their body's natural hunger and fullness cues. This practice encourages thoughtful decision-making when selecting foods, promoting choices that align with personal health goals.
Eliminating distractions during meals, such as televisions or mobile devices, enhances the ability to concentrate on the sensory aspects of food, including taste, texture, and aroma. Chewing food thoroughly not only aids digestion but also extends the mealtime experience, reducing the likelihood of overeating. Additionally, observing emotional triggers that prompt eating, such as stress or boredom, can help in managing these situations with non-food-related coping mechanisms.
Portioning meals intentionally and serving food on smaller plates can also encourage better portion control, as it creates a sense of satisfaction with less food. Allowing sufficient time to eat and acknowledging the enjoyment of food fosters a positive relationship with eating. These mindful practices help create sustainable habits that support both immediate nutritional needs and long-term health.

Overcoming Common Challenges in Weight Management
Weight management often comes with a range of challenges that require thoughtful strategies to address effectively. One common issue is the difficulty in breaking long-standing unhealthy eating habits. Identifying triggers for such behaviours, such as stress or convenience, and replacing them with positive practices can lead to significant improvements. Emotional eating, which is often prompted by feelings such as stress, anxiety, or boredom, is another obstacle that individuals frequently encounter. Building awareness of these emotions and finding non-food-related coping mechanisms can help mitigate their impact on eating patterns.
Social settings can also present challenges, as gatherings often involve calorie-dense foods and drinks. Learning to make balanced choices while still enjoying the occasion helps maintain greater consistency in achieving weight management goals. Additionally, time constraints can hinder meal preparation, leading individuals to rely on processed or fast foods. Practical solutions, such as batch cooking or choosing simple, nutrient-rich recipes, can help overcome this barrier.
Plateaus, where weight loss temporarily slows or stops, may also occur and can be discouraging. Assessing changes in activity levels or dietary habits and making adjustments to exercise or meal plans often helps re-establish progress. Addressing these challenges with patience and a structured approach can support sustainable and effective weight management.
